1. One-Pan Chicken and Veggies
This one-pan meal is not only easy to make but also minimizes cleanup. Simply toss your favorite vegetables and chicken breasts with olive oil, salt, and pepper, and roast in the oven at 400°F for 25-30 minutes. For an extra flavor boost, add some garlic powder or Italian seasoning before baking.
2. Speedy Spaghetti Aglio e Olio
A classic Italian dish that's ready in the time it takes to boil pasta. Cook spaghetti according to package instructions. Meanwhile, sauté minced garlic in olive oil until golden, then toss with the cooked pasta, red pepper flakes, and a handful of chopped parsley. Serve with grated Parmesan cheese for a simple yet satisfying meal.
3. Quick and Easy Stir-Fry
Stir-fries are the ultimate weeknight dinner. Use whatever protein and vegetables you have on hand. Cook your protein first, set aside, then stir-fry your veggies. Add a simple sauce made from soy sauce, a bit of sugar, and water, then combine everything and serve over rice or noodles.
4. 15-Minute Black Bean Quesadillas
For a vegetarian option that's packed with protein, try these black bean quesadillas. Mash canned black beans with some taco seasoning, spread on a tortilla, top with cheese and another tortilla, and cook in a skillet until golden and crispy. Serve with salsa and sour cream for dipping.
5. No-Cook Summer Rolls
Perfect for warmer evenings, these no-cook summer rolls are light and refreshing. Fill rice paper wrappers with thinly sliced vegetables, cooked shrimp or tofu, and fresh herbs. Serve with a peanut or hoisin dipping sauce for a meal that's as fun to make as it is to eat.
